Tombstone leans fully into its Wild West identity. Gunfights, saloons, and storytelling that blurs fact and legend, all packed into a walkable, slightly gritty town that doesn’t take itself too seriously.
The level of protection at Kartchner Caverns State Park. No personal items allowed inside, shoes are sanitized to prevent the spread of White-nose syndrome, and airlocks and misting systems are used to maintain humidity and temperature.
